After installing El Capitan, right click does not work in Illustrator.

After installing El Capitan, right click does not work in Illustrator. Works in Photoshop. I've restarted with no luck. Seems minor but turning into a serious productivity issue.

Anyone else having this issue?

    Correct answer AshutoshChaturvedi

    Hello,

    We have fixed this issue in our latest CC 2015.2 update. Please apply the patch using Adobe Creative Cloud application.

    If you do not see the patch right away

    1. Go to Adobe Creative Cloud application
    2. Click on the Gear icon on the top right
    3. From the menu select “Check for App Updates”
